I have PostgreSQL v9.4.4 running in my environment. It has been up for over
2 years now. I noticed that suddenly the statistics have been reset and all
the stat tables/columns got restarted from.

This happened 2 weeks ago. I noticed only recently after I looked at the
plot over last week (which dipped suddenly for "number of tuples returned",
"number of conflicts" etc).

The columns which got reset are from pg_stat_database, pg_stat_user_tables,
pg_stat_bgwriter

As far I know no one has fired pg_stat_reset or pg_stat_reset_shared.

I noticed that the last largest value is from pg_stat_user_tables.
tup_returned (470440261405). Does the statistics get reset automatically
when the value for one of the statistics reaches the high number supported
by int4?

I am running on Red Hat 6.7.
